Redis分布式缓存众多优势一览无余(分布式缓存redis优点)

Redis分布式缓存作为主流缓存服务方案之一,受到众多开发人员和企业的青睐。其本身优势非常强大,深得开发者们的喜爱。本文就介绍Redis分布式缓存的众多优势一览无余,以及相关的实例。

Redis分布式缓存的性能非常优异, response latencies are quite minimal. 对于经常从数据库获取大量数据的应用,可以利用Redis分布式缓存**加快访问速度**,提升系统性能。与常规缓存方案相比,Redis可以**支持大容量数据**,因此不存在数据容量上的瓶颈。

Redis分布式缓存可以**支持分布式部署**,即可以把缓存分散到多台服务器上,减轻单个服务器的压力。另外,由于Redis支持数据持久化,可以**提供持久化数据库的能力**,从而**大大减少了服务器的开销**。

此外,Redis可以**支持一致性hash分片**,便于把不同的服务器上的数据均衡地进行分片,从而**解决性能瓶颈问题**。此外,它还**支持缓存雪崩、缓存击穿**等各种缓存问题,使系统更加弹性高效稳定。

Redis分布式缓存**易于学习和使用**,它的文档和教程非常充足,同时语言支持也十分广泛,它可以在各种编程语言中使用,支持的语言包括Python、C、Java、PHP等,所以开发者可以很轻松地使用Redis搭建自己的分布式缓存系统。

综上所述,Redis分布式缓存在众多优势中表现良好,可以说是众多缓存服务方案中的佼佼者,也值得开发者们重视。

示例代码:

“`Python

#使用redis-py操作redis

import redis

#建立连接

r = redis.Redis(host=’localhost’, port=6379, db=0)

#设置单个值

r.set(‘test1’, ‘test1 value’)

#获取单个值

value = r.get(‘test1’)

print(value)


      

数据运维技术 » Redis分布式缓存众多优势一览无余(分布式缓存redis优点)